Ejercicio Python: Convierte una cadena a un número entero.

  Ejercicios

Objetivo del Ejercicio Python: Convierte una cadena a un número entero.

En este ejercicio de programación en Python, el objetivo es convertir una cadena de caracteres en un número entero. Esto puede ser útil en situaciones donde se necesite realizar cálculos matemáticos o manipular números en lugar de cadenas de texto.

Python proporciona una función incorporada llamada `int()` que permite realizar esta conversión de manera sencilla. Sin embargo, es importante tener en cuenta que la cadena debe cumplir con ciertas condiciones para poder ser convertida correctamente.

El objetivo principal de este ejercicio es aprender a utilizar la función `int()` de Python y comprender cómo se realiza la conversión de cadenas a números enteros.

Cómo hacer el Ejercicio Python: Convierte una cadena a un número entero.

Para convertir una cadena a un número entero en Python, se utiliza la función `int()`. Esta función toma como argumento una cadena y devuelve el número entero equivalente. Sin embargo, es importante tener en cuenta que la cadena debe contener únicamente caracteres numéricos, de lo contrario se generará un error.

Ejercicio Python: Encuentra la suma de los cubos de los primeros N números.Ejercicio Python: Encuentra la suma de los cubos de los primeros N números.

Aquí tienes un ejemplo de cómo utilizar la función `int()` para convertir una cadena a un número entero:


cadena = "123"
numero = int(cadena)
print(numero)

En este ejemplo, la variable `cadena` contiene la cadena de caracteres “123”. Al utilizar la función `int()` para convertir esta cadena en un número entero, se almacena el valor resultante en la variable `numero`. Finalmente, se imprime el valor de `numero`, que en este caso será el número entero 123.

Es importante mencionar que si la cadena contiene caracteres que no son numéricos, se generará un error. Por ejemplo, si intentamos convertir la cadena “123abc”, se generará un ValueError.

Solución al Ejercicio Python: Convierte una cadena a un número entero.

Para resolver el ejercicio de convertir una cadena a un número entero en Python, se puede utilizar la siguiente solución:

Ejercicio Python: Encuentra el volumen de un cilindro.Ejercicio Python: Encuentra el volumen de un cilindro.

def convertir_a_entero(cadena):
    try:
        numero = int(cadena)
        return numero
    except ValueError:
        return "La cadena no se puede convertir a un número entero"

cadena = input("Ingrese una cadena: ")
numero_entero = convertir_a_entero(cadena)
print(numero_entero)

En esta solución, se define una función llamada `convertir_a_entero()` que toma como argumento una cadena. Dentro de la función, se utiliza un bloque try-except para manejar el posible error generado por la función `int()` en caso de que la cadena no pueda ser convertida a un número entero. Si la conversión es exitosa, se devuelve el número entero. En caso contrario, se devuelve un mensaje de error.

Luego, se solicita al usuario ingresar una cadena utilizando la función `input()`, y se llama a la función `convertir_a_entero()` pasando como argumento la cadena ingresada. Finalmente, se imprime el resultado de la conversión.

Esta solución permite convertir una cadena a un número entero en Python de manera segura, manejando posibles errores y asegurando que la cadena cumpla con las condiciones necesarias para la conversión.